Albany County Executive Daniel McCoy is taking his office on the road at the end of next week. He has scheduled office hours in Knox, Berne and Rensselaerville July 20th23rd. I have said since the first day I took office that what happens in Albany impacts those who live in the hilltowns and vice versa, said McCoy. I understand that not everyone can drive into Albany to talk about what may be on their mind. Thats why Im taking my office to them. McCoy will be available as follows: Friday, July 20 9 a.m. - 1 p.m. Knox Town Hall 2192 Berne-Altamont Road, Knox Saturday, July 21 8 a.m. - noon Starts Fox Creek 5k Run @ Berne Town Park then Hilltown Community Market (across from Berne Town Hall 1656 Helderberg Trail, Berne) Monday, July 23 9 a.m. - 1 p.m. Rensselaerville Town Hall 87 Barger Road, Rensselaerville
